Overview of Central Java
• Area: 39,800.69 km2
• Population: 32.9 million which provides a young and technically trained workforce
• GDP Growth (2012): 6%
• Provincial Capital: Semarang

Kendal Industrial Park Conceptual Master plan
• Total Development: 2,700 Hectares
• Mixed use development: encompassing mainly industrial use, as well as residential & commercial
• Water-front land: facing northern coast of Central Java

Excellent Infrastructure
Kendal Industrial Park will be equipped with international standard infrastructure
and supporting amenities to take care of your business needs
• Prepared land plots for custom-built factory
• Ready-built factories
• Reliable electricity, water & waste-water treatment
• Executive housing with full-fledge amenities
• Well-managed worker dormitories
